How can you create a Command Prompt shortcut (see the following picture) on the desktop of Windows 10 computer? The article introduces two simple methods to do the trick.

Step 1: Find Command Prompt.
Click the bottom-left Start button, type cmd in the search box and locate Command Prompt in the results.

Step 2: Open its file location.
Right-tap Command Prompt and select Open file location.

Step 3: Send the Command Prompt shortcut to desktop.
Right-click the Command Prompt shortcut, point at Send to in the context menu, and choose Desktop (create shortcut) in the sub-list.

Step 1: Open a new shortcut on the desktop.
Right-tap desktop, point at New in the menu and select Shortcut.

Step 2: Input the location of Command Prompt and move on.
Type %windir%\system32\cmd.exe in the empty box, and tap Next.

Step 3: Name the shortcut and finish creating it.
Type Command Prompt as the shortcut's name, and click Finish.
